locus

 
Noun locus has 3 senses
  1. venue, locale, locus - the scene of any event or action (especially the place of a meeting)
    --1 is a kind of scene
  2. locus - the specific site of a particular gene on its chromosome
    --2 is a kind of
    site, situation
  3. locus - the set of all points or lines that satisfy or are determined by specific conditions; "the locus of points equidistant from a given point is a circle"
    --3 is a kind of
    set
